<?php
namespace Symfony\Bundle\FrameworkBundle\Tests\CacheWarmer;
use Doctrine\Common\Annotations\AnnotationReader;
use Doctrine\Common\Annotations\CachedReader;
use Doctrine\Common\Annotations\Reader;
use PHPUnit\Framework\MockObject\MockObject;
use Symfony\Bundle\FrameworkBundle\CacheWarmer\AnnotationsCacheWarmer;
use Symfony\Bundle\FrameworkBundle\Tests\TestCase;
use Symfony\Component\Cache\Adapter\NullAdapter;
use Symfony\Component\Cache\Adapter\PhpArrayAdapter;
use Symfony\Component\Cache\DoctrineProvider;
use Symfony\Component\Filesystem\Filesystem;
class AnnotationsCacheWarmerTest extends TestCase
{
private $cacheDir;
protected function setUp(): void
{
$this->cacheDir = sys_get_temp_dir().'/'.uniqid();
$fs = new Filesystem();
$fs->mkdir($this->cacheDir);
parent::setUp();
}
protected function tearDown(): void
{
$fs = new Filesystem();
$fs->remove($this->cacheDir);
parent::tearDown();
}
public function testAnnotationsCacheWarmerWithDebugDisabled()
{
file_put_contents($this->cacheDir.'/annotations.map', sprintf('<?php return %s;', var_export([__CLASS__], true)));
$cacheFile = tempnam($this->cacheDir, __FUNCTION__);
$reader = new AnnotationReader();
$warmer = new AnnotationsCacheWarmer($reader, $cacheFile);
$warmer->warmUp($this->cacheDir);
$this->assertFileExists($cacheFile);
// Assert cache is valid
$reader = new CachedReader(
$this->getReadOnlyReader(),
new DoctrineProvider(new PhpArrayAdapter($cacheFile, new NullAdapter()))
);
$refClass = new \ReflectionClass($this);
$reader->getClassAnnotations($refClass);
$reader->getMethodAnnotations($refClass->getMethod(__FUNCTION__));
$reader->getPropertyAnnotations($refClass->getProperty('cacheDir'));
}
public function testAnnotationsCacheWarmerWithDebugEnabled()
{
file_put_contents($this->cacheDir.'/annotations.map', sprintf('<?php return %s;', var_export([__CLASS__], true)));
$cacheFile = tempnam($this->cacheDir, __FUNCTION__);
$reader = new AnnotationReader();
$warmer = new AnnotationsCacheWarmer($reader, $cacheFile, null, true);
$warmer->warmUp($this->cacheDir);
$this->assertFileExists($cacheFile);
// Assert cache is valid
$reader = new CachedReader(
$this->getReadOnlyReader(),
new DoctrineProvider(new PhpArrayAdapter($cacheFile, new NullAdapter())),
true
);
$refClass = new \ReflectionClass($this);
$reader->getClassAnnotations($refClass);
$reader->getMethodAnnotations($refClass->getMethod(__FUNCTION__));
$reader->getPropertyAnnotations($refClass->getProperty('cacheDir'));
}
/**
* Test that the cache warming process is not broken if a class loader
* throws an exception (on class / file not found for example).
*/
public function testClassAutoloadException()
{
$this->assertFalse(class_exists($annotatedClass = 'C\C\C', false));
file_put_contents($this->cacheDir.'/annotations.map', sprintf('<?php return %s;', var_export([$annotatedClass], true)));
$warmer = new AnnotationsCacheWarmer(new AnnotationReader(), tempnam($this->cacheDir, __FUNCTION__));
spl_autoload_register($classLoader = function ($class) use ($annotatedClass) {
if ($class === $annotatedClass) {
throw new \DomainException('This exception should be caught by the warmer.');
}
}, true, true);
$warmer->warmUp($this->cacheDir);
spl_autoload_unregister($classLoader);
}
/**
* Test that the cache warming process is broken if a class loader throws an
* exception but that is unrelated to the class load.
*/
public function testClassAutoloadExceptionWithUnrelatedException()
{
$this->expectException(\DomainException::class);
$this->expectExceptionMessage('This exception should not be caught by the warmer.');
$this->assertFalse(class_exists($annotatedClass = 'AClassThatDoesNotExist_FWB_CacheWarmer_AnnotationsCacheWarmerTest', false));
file_put_contents($this->cacheDir.'/annotations.map', sprintf('<?php return %s;', var_export([$annotatedClass], true)));
$warmer = new AnnotationsCacheWarmer(new AnnotationReader(), tempnam($this->cacheDir, __FUNCTION__));
spl_autoload_register($classLoader = function ($class) use ($annotatedClass) {
if ($class === $annotatedClass) {
eval('class '.$annotatedClass.'{}');
throw new \DomainException('This exception should not be caught by the warmer.');
}
}, true, true);
$warmer->warmUp($this->cacheDir);
spl_autoload_unregister($classLoader);
}
/**
* @return MockObject|Reader
*/
private function getReadOnlyReader()
{
$readerMock = $this->getMockBuilder('Doctrine\Common\Annotations\Reader')->getMock();
$readerMock->expects($this->exactly(0))->method('getClassAnnotations');
$readerMock->expects($this->exactly(0))->method('getClassAnnotation');
$readerMock->expects($this->exactly(0))->method('getMethodAnnotations');
$readerMock->expects($this->exactly(0))->method('getMethodAnnotation');
$readerMock->expects($this->exactly(0))->method('getPropertyAnnotations');
$readerMock->expects($this->exactly(0))->method('getPropertyAnnotation');
return $readerMock;
}
}
